  • Q1. What is the difference between tubes and pipes?
  • Ans. 

    Tubes are generally used for structural purposes and have a higher strength-to-weight ratio, while pipes are used for conveying fluids and gases.

    • Tubes are measured by their outside diameter and wall thickness, while pipes are measured by their inside diameter.

    • Tubes are typically used in structural applications such as construction and automotive industries, while pipes are used for conveying fluids and gases.

    • Tubes have...

Why are women still asked such personal questions in interview?
I recently went for an interview… and honestly, m still trying to process what just happened. Instead of being asked about my skills, experience, or how I could add value to the company… the questions took a totally unexpected turn. The interviewer started asking things like When are you getting married? Are you engaged? And m sure, if I had said I was married, the next question would’ve been How long have you been married? What does my personal life have to do with the job m applying for? This is where I felt the gender discrimination hit hard. These types of questions are so casually thrown at women during interviews but are they ever asked to men? No one asks male candidates if they’re planning a wedding or how old their kids are. So why is it okay to ask women? Can we please stop normalising this kind of behaviour in interviews? Our careers shouldn’t be judged by our relationship status. Period.
